What Happens in a Pit Stop?

Modern pit stops are almost unreal in their speed and precision. In under 2.5 seconds, an entire team executes a highly complex sequence:

  • The car enters the pit box and stops on exact marks

  • Air jacks instantly lift the car off the ground

  • Four wheel guns remove the wheel nuts simultaneously

  • Old tyres are taken off and replaced with fresh rubber

  • Wheel guns refit and secure all four wheels

  • The car is dropped back to the ground

  • The driver accelerates back into the pit lane and rejoins the track

All of this happens in a controlled explosion of movement, noise, and timing, where even the smallest hesitation can cost valuable positions on track.


Why It Matters So Much

In Formula One, strategy is just as important as speed. A perfectly timed pit stop can:

  • Undercut a rival by gaining track position

  • Overcut opponents by extending stint performance

  • React instantly to changing weather or safety cars

  • Salvage positions during unexpected race situations

A slow or poorly executed stop, however, can undo an entire race’s worth of effort in seconds.

The Science of Repetition: How F1 Pit Stops Are Perfected

In the world of Formula One, a pit stop lasting barely over two seconds is the result of hundreds of hours of repetition, precision, and teamwork. While race-day execution looks effortless, the real work happens long before the cars ever reach the grid.

A typical Grand Prix weekend alone can include around 60 practice pit stops, all designed to sharpen consistency, reaction time, and coordination across the entire crew.


A Weekend Built on Practice

Pit stop training is carefully structured across the race weekend:

  • Thursday: Around 20 practice stops
    This is a key training day where crew members rotate roles, learning different responsibilities within the stop to ensure flexibility and depth within the team.

  • Friday morning: Around 15 stops
    Focus shifts to refining timing and consistency under increasing pressure.

  • During practice sessions: Additional live drills
    These simulate real-world conditions and unexpected scenarios.

  • Saturday morning: Around 20 stops
    This session reinforces precision ahead of qualifying and race simulations.

  • Sunday morning: Final tune-up stops
    These are usually shorter and focused on maintaining sharpness before lights out.

Specialised drills are also included throughout the weekend, such as nose changes, emergency procedures, and spare wheel gun swaps, ensuring crews are prepared for any situation that may arise during a race.


A Team Effort Like No Other

A modern pit stop in Formula One is not just fast—it’s a perfectly synchronised operation involving up to 22 team members, each with a critical role.

The structure includes:

  • 12 crew members dedicated to tyre changes

    • 3 per wheel: one removes and tightens the wheel nut, one removes the old tyre, and one fits the new tyre
  • Front and rear jack operators
    Responsible for lifting and lowering the car in perfect timing

  • Backup jack operators
    Positioned in case of a double-stack situation or mechanical issue

Each role must be executed with exact timing. Even a fraction of a second’s delay can disrupt the entire stop.

Why Consistency Matters More Than Speed Alone

While headlines often focus on sub-2.5-second stops, the real key to success is consistency across an entire season. A slightly slower but flawless stop every time is far more valuable than occasional record-breaking performances followed by mistakes.

That reliability can directly influence race outcomes, championship points, and strategic decisions across a season.

Inside a Modern F1 Pit Stop: Precision, Roles, and Split-Second Timing

In the world of Formula One, a pit stop is not just a tyre change—it is a fully coordinated operation involving up to 22 specialists working in perfect synchronization, where every movement is measured in fractions of a second.

Each role inside the pit crew is carefully defined to ensure speed, safety, and absolute accuracy under extreme pressure.


The Supporting Roles in the Middle of the Car

At the heart of the operation are two stabilising crew members, positioned centrally along the car while it is balanced on its jacks. Their responsibility is to keep the car steady during the stop and assist with essential maintenance tasks if required, such as:

  • Cleaning radiators to maintain airflow efficiency

  • Wiping driver visors for visibility

  • Adjusting mirrors for optimal race visibility

These tasks, though secondary to tyre changes, can be crucial in maintaining performance and safety during a race.

Front Wing Adjustments

At each front corner of the car, two dedicated crew members handle front wing adjustments. These adjustments allow teams to fine-tune aerodynamic balance depending on race conditions, tyre wear, or strategic changes.

Even a small adjustment can influence handling significantly, making this role both technical and highly sensitive.


Pit Stop Control and Release System

One of the most critical roles in the entire pit lane is the release controller, who manages pit lane traffic and ultimately decides when the car is safe to rejoin the track.

This individual oversees the pit stop gantry system and gives the final “green light” signal once all checks are complete.

Alongside them is a second crew member who monitors the stop from a different angle. This additional layer of oversight ensures that no mistakes are missed, and they also have the authority to override the release if any issue is detected.

Only when both confirm safety does the system allow the driver to leave.


The Moment of Release

Once the green light appears:

  • All wheel nuts are confirmed secure

  • The pit lane is clear of traffic

  • The driver is cleared to accelerate out of the box

At that moment, the driver reacts instantly—releasing the clutch, applying throttle, and rejoining the circuit in one fluid motion.


Timing Measured in Fractions of a Second

Every phase of a modern pit stop in Formula One is executed with extreme precision:

  • Car jacking and wheel nut removal: ~0.4 seconds

  • Wheel changeover: ~1.0 second

  • Wheel tightening: ~0.3 seconds

  • Car drop to the ground: <0.1 seconds

  • Driver reaction and launch: ~0.3 seconds

Altogether, the entire process often completes in around two seconds or less.
